As an On-Site Specialist, you’ll bring technical skills and a service-focused mindset to provide service to minimally invasive surgical procedures. You’ll assist in the operating room, maintain surgical equipment, and help keep everything running smoothly behind the scenes. It’s a fast-paced role with real impact on patient care. What you will do: • Facilitate the use of Stryker Endoscopy equipment in coordination with the OnSite Specialists team, surgical teams, Sterile Processing teams, and biomedical teams, while maintaining OnSite Operations standards and expectations. • Ensure Stryker Endoscopy equipment is properly prepared, fully operational, and compliant with standards to enable safe and efficient surgical procedures. • Proactively identify the needs of surgical teams and address equipment issues promptly and effectively. • Troubleshoot and repair surgical devices to maintain peak performance. • Maintain up-to-date product knowledge through Stryker training and communicate key insights to clinical teams. • Document and communicate data to contribute to ongoing improvement efforts. • Adhere to all safety guidelines and regulatory standards, including HIPAA and patient privacy requirements. • Meet work schedule and on-call duties to ensure consistent surgical coverage as required by the medical facility. What you need: Required Qualifications • High school diploma or high school equivalent degree. • 0+ years of experience in customer service or technical assistance roles. •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s occasionally, move up to 20 lbs continuously, and perform tasks requiring standing, walking, visual acuity, color vision, and manual dexterity daily. • Strong communication, time management, and critical thinking skills. • Proficiency in Microsoft Office. • Ability to obtain HSPA certification within 6 months of hire (with annual renewal). Preferred Qualifications • Associate or bachelor’s degree, or relevant medical certifications. • Experience in operating rooms or with surgical equipment. • Experience in Sterile Processing (HSPA/CRCST certification preferred).
